    I have been sent some books by email for my Kindle. However i have absolutely NO idea how to get them on to the Kindle.

    I have downloaded the links to my Macbook and when i go to open them it just says that they cant be opened as there is no supporting app.

    I suggest you install Calibre for Mac - this is brilliant free e-library management software. You can add your books from your laptop and then set it up to transfer them via cable or email to your Kindle. It streamlines the organisation of all your books and can even convert from one format to another. Although it is free, I think it's one piece of software that's worth a donation every now and then.

    Calibre also makes it easy to sideload ebooks bought from sources other than Amazon onto your kindle.
